How to fill out the No Harm Contract online

The No Harm Contract is an essential document designed to promote safety and establish commitments to avoid harm. This guide will provide you with clear, instructive steps to complete the contract efficiently online.

Follow the steps to fill out the No Harm Contract online

  1. Click the 'Get Form' button to access the No Harm Contract. This will allow you to download and open the contract in an online editor.
  2. Begin by entering the date at the top of the form to indicate when the contract is being filled out.
  3. In the designated line, write your full name clearly to indicate your commitment.
  4. Specify the date for your follow-up appointment with the Counselor, marking the period until which you are guaranteeing no harm.
  5. In the next section, affirm your promise to refrain from harming anyone by checking the box or indicating your acceptance of this commitment.
  6. List five coping skills that you will use if you feel urges to harm someone, detailing strategies that work for you.
  7. Under the 'Contact People' section, write the names and phone numbers of individuals you can reach out to in times of crisis.
  8. In the event that your contact people cannot be reached, record the crisis numbers provided in the document to ensure you have access to support.
  9. Acknowledge that your parent or guardian will be informed about your situation, if necessary, ensuring responsible communication.
  10. Sign and date the form at the bottom where it indicates 'Client’s Signature' and 'Counselor’s Signature,' also providing the Counselor’s phone number.

“Contracts for safety,” “NSCs,” and “no-suicide decisions” are common terms used to describe an agreement between the patient and clinician whereby the patient agrees not to harm him or herself. The agreements are usually written but are sometimes verbal. 2. These terms are often used interchangeably by providers.

Results: Diagnostically, the No Harm Contract can be used to assess the nature and severity of a patient's suicidality, uncover specific troubling issues precipitating suicidal thoughts, and evaluate the patient's competency to contract.

“No Harm Contracts” are known by many different names including “Safety Contract,” “Contract For Safety,” “No Suicide Contract” etc. They may be either written or verbal with the common feature being that the client promises not to hurt or kill themselves.
